Le or La?

vous la recouvrez avec le reste de la ganache ! as given in the correct text.


Here does not 'le' refer to la ganache? So should it not be "La reste de la ganache?"

MaartenC1 Kwiziq Q&A super contributor Correct answer

Paul,  ‘ (le) reste ’ is a noun, not an adjective and is always masculine. 

Nouns don’t take agreement with each other in phrases or expressions.
